What are the rails in a filing cabinet called?
File bars (sometimes called file rails) are used in file cabinets to create a hanging structure for hanging file folders. These file rails are for lateral file cabinets. You can create front-to-back or side-to-side filing depending on your needs with these file bars (file rails).
What is the alternative to filing cabinets?
There are smaller and more affordable alternatives to filing cabinets that can be used for organizing your classroom files. You can use accordion bins for record keeping, file box containers, mobile file storage carts, collapsible file cube boxes, or milk crates.

How do lateral files work?
Lateral filing is when papers are added from the side of the file and the identification tab is on the side of the file. To pull the document out, you grab the sides edges. The main benefit of this type of filing system is that it is more space efficient.

Can you use a dresser as a filing cabinet?
With just some cabinet hardware, and a twist of the screwdriver, you can convert a bedroom dresser into a great looking and functional filing cabinet. Insert metal file folder suspension frames into each drawer. Add file folders into the sleeves in an appropriate filing category.
